On Thursday, Rep. Jamaal Bowman turned himself in to police for pulling the fire alarm in a Capitol office building during a meeting on a Republican-backed stopgap bill to keep the government funded past the Sept. 30 deadline.
The Democratic congressman has agreed to plead guilty after reaching an agreement with the Washington DC attorney general that will result in his “false fire alarm” charge being dropped. According to Fox News, the “Squad” member surrendered to law enforcement Thursday morning, and will be arraigned.
